Oval Platter
This platter was originally part of a large dinner service ordered by George Hyde Clark in November 1833 from New York retailer Baldwin Gardiner, described in the original bill as “One Porcelain Dinning [sic] and dessr [sic] Service, rich bouquet and yellow border.”
